Club Brugge forward Wesley Moraes has revealed that he wants to move to the Premier League this summer amid reported interest from Arsenal.

The 22-year-old has been in impressive form for Club Brugge this season, finding the back of the net on 14 occasions in 39 appearances, in addition to contributing nine assists.

The Brazilian has revealed that he will look to leave Belgium this summer and is eyeing a switch to England.

"I have read all those names. It is of course completely different going to China than to another European country. I don't know what I want, I don't want to exclude anything," Moraes told Het Belang van Limburg.

"I do know that I once said that I want to go to England and that is still the case. I have always closely followed the Premier League. But I am certainly also open to other leagues."

Moraes started his professional career with Slovakian side Trencin before making the move to Club Brugge in January 2016.

The South American has a contract at the Jan Breydel Stadium until the end of the 2022-23 campaign.
